FINISHING: 1.
Pour a 6” wide line of finish alo
ng the starting wall. Go with the grain of the wood.
2.
Using a pre
-
dampened
applicator
, draw the applicator forward with the grain of the wood,
moving the finish toward the opposite wall. To maintain a wet edge at all times, hold the applicator
at a snowp
low angle.
3.
At the end of each run, turn the applicator towards you and pad out the
applicator parallel to the wet edge.
4.
Feather out all turns. Do not push too hard or too fast to avoid drips
flying off the applicator.
5.
BE SURE YOU ARE USING THE RECOMMENDED COVERAGE OF 350
-
400
SQ. FT. PER GALLON. DO NOT SPREAD TOO THIN.
6.
Allow the first coat to dry 2
-
3 hours. High
humidity and/or low temperature conditions will extend the dry time (reco
mmended conditions of 65
-
80°
F/
40
-
60% relative humidity).
7.
F
or smoothest results, abrade with a Bona
®
Conditioning Pad before
applying final coat. Always vacuum and tack thoroughly with a slightly water dampened Bona Microfiber
Mop or cloth after abrading. Allow final coat to dry at least
48
hours before use.
CAUT
ION!
Do not recap finish/hardener mixture after 4 hours to avoid pressure build
-
up. Dispose of any
remaining product in accordance with local, state and federal regulations. Decontaminate empty hardener
(Part B) bottle prior to disposal by adding water to
the one
-
quart line. Recap. Shake vigorously. Dispose
of.
POT LIFE:
THE FINISH/HARDENER MIXTURE MUST BE USED WITHIN 4 HOURS AFTER IT IS
MIXED. Product properties are diminished after 4 hours. The finish and hardener can be mixed only one
time.
INTERCOAT
ABRASION:
It is not necessary to abrade between Bona waterborne sealer and finish coats
unless more than 48 hours has passed since the previous coat was applied. For smoothest results,
abrade between all coats as necessary. When using solvent
-
based sealers, ALWAYS abrade before
finish coats. Always vacuum and tack thoroughly with a slightly water
-
dampened Bona Microfiber Mop or
cloth after abrading.
RECOATING:
BONA RECOAT SYSTEM
: Guaranteed recoat system designed to safely remove all contaminan
ts and
prepare the floor surface for optimal adhesion of Bona Traffic HD
®
. See Bona Recoat System for
application directions.
WHEN USING BONA PREP SYSTEM:
Be sure floor is free from wax, polish and oily residues. Follow the
Bona Prep
®
system, applying 1
-2 coats of Bona Traffic
HD™
finish. Delamination can occur if the Bona
Prep process is not followed; always test for compatibility.
NOTE: Bona Traffic HD™ will adhere to most
stains and finishes after proper preparation and dry times. Stain, sealer and fini
sh results may vary widely
depending on the wood species, especially on oily and resinous Exotics. ALWAYS PREPARE A SAMPLE
OR TEST AREA TO DETERMINE COMPATIBILITY, APPEARANCE AND DESIRED RESULTS.
CURING:
The curing process
takes approximately 7 days, (
80
% cured after 1 day, 90% after 3 days). Do
not replace area rugs until the floor has fully cured. The floor may be walked on after 24 hours, but
remains susceptible to scuffing or marring until completely cured.
Furniture may
be placed onto floor after
72 hours (90% cured). Do not drag or slide furniture.
Use only a dry Bona Microfiber Mop or cloth for
cleaning during the first week.
CLEAN
-
UP:
Application tools should be cleaned with water and stored in an airtight container.
FLOOR CARE:
Put walk
-
off mats at all entrance doorways to minimize dirt and grit. Sweep or vacuum
daily and damp
-
wipe as needed with Bona
®
Professional Series Hardwood Floor Cleaner
. Use felt pads
under furniture legs and appliances.
STORAGE:
Nonflammable
-
Bona Traffic and Hardener should be stored in a climate controlled
environment. KEEP FROM FREEZING. Do
not store above 100° F (38° C).
